Grammy Winners - Buddy Guy - John Legend and The Roots

Talked about the 53rd Grammys and the Best Contemporary Blues Album nominations in particular recently on here, and so at a guess would say that the actual winner may stir some interest.

The actual winning album of this category was...

Living Proof - Buddy Guy

Video clip below..

Also worth a mention was John Legend and The Roots who's recent collaboration lp "Wake Up Everybody" has been talked about a fair few times on here and certainly provided my ears with some enjoyment in 2010.

They were both up for a few awards, and they picked up the two ones below..

Best R&B Album

Wake Up! - John Legend & The Roots

Best Traditional R&B Vocal Performance

"Hang On in There" - John Legend & The Roots
